Question:

Select the correct indirect form of the given sentence.

 

Mohan said to' Radha, "Who were you speaking to over the phone?"

Options:

Mohan asked Radha who she had been speaking to over the phone.

Mohan ask Radha who she have been speaking to over the phone.

Mohan asked Radha who she was speaks to over the phone.

Mohan asks Radha who she had been speaking at the phone.

Correct Answer:

Mohan asked Radha who she had been speaking to over the phone.

Explanation:

The correct indirect form of the given sentence is:

Mohan asked Radha who she had been speaking to over the phone.

The other options are incorrect for the following reasons:

  • Mohan ask Radha who she have been speaking to over the phone. The verb "have" should be in the past perfect tense, "had".
  • Mohan asked Radha who she was speaks to over the phone. The verb "speaks" should be in the present participle tense, "speaking".
  • Mohan asks Radha who she had been speaking at the phone. The preposition "at" should be "to".
